Back in cinemas for its 50th anniversary, Spielberg’s iconic summer blockbuster is a judicious hit of pure terror enhanced by one of the greatest scores of all time. 

When a murderous great white begins a killing spree off the shores of Amity Island, police chief Martin Brody (Roy Schneider) wants to close the beaches, but mayor Larry Vaughn (Murray Hamilton) overrules him. Instead, an ichthyologist (Richard Dreyfuss), a grizzled ship captain (Robert Shaw) join Brody on a voyage to kill the shark in the open sea: setting the stage for an epic and unforgettable battle of man vs. beast.
